I went overboard with the price. The 180-200 nm process machines cost around $50-100 million.
But ASML is the only current maker of extreme-UV (~13 nm) litho tools that are ready, or close to ready, for production use in real fabs.
Apart from ASML, currently only Nikon, Canon and Panasonic makes the litho machines but for much higher nm nodes.
85% of world supply is being done by ASML.

Yes, can be and should be done. This is how many south asian countries started FAB work, They purchased the machines from declining plants from EU and US and started in their countries.
Big process nodes like 180nm and 200nm are still in production. Z80 microcontroller is still produced and used in electronics. Other than consumer grade processors, most of the electronic stuff does not need extremely now node process.
